The Original Louis Drive in Restaurant, Family restaurant in North Knoxville, United States.
The Original Louis Drive-In Restaurant is a family dining spot in North Knoxville that serves Greek and Italian-American dishes made in-house. The kitchen turns out large portions of homemade pasta and hand-breaded onion rings prepared using techniques passed down over decades.
This restaurant was founded in 1958 and has kept its reputation alive through generations of families preparing traditional recipes. The long continuity shows how it became rooted in the North Knoxville community over many years.
The restaurant shows how Greek families brought their approach to Italian-American cooking to Tennessee, blending their own food traditions with the cuisine they adopted. This mixing is visible in the way dishes are prepared and seasoned today.
The restaurant offers family packs for gatherings and has a curbside pickup service starting at 4 PM for convenient meal collection. These options work well for people who want quick dining or need to pick up food for a group.
The kitchen makes its own pastrami and creates a distinctive sauce that tastes more like Cincinnati-style chili than traditional meat sauce. This unusual flavor combination is a signature of the place and sets it apart from other Italian-American restaurants.
